What you’ll learn:
Fundamentals of object-oriented programming
Classes and objects
Control flow
Variables and data types
Object state
Methods and constructors
Mistakes to avoid
Concatenation
Internal and external method calls
Collections and Looping
Array and ArrayList
Importing packages
Identity vs equality
Exception handling
The Iterator class
Debugging Java applications
Abstraction and modularization
Build small projects like Chess and Bank Account
And much more.
Requirements:
No coding experience necessary.
No advanced math experience necessary.
Description:
Learn object-oriented programming in the most popular programming language behind your favorite apps and websites.
Must-Know Software Developer Fundamentals Course
Java is the most in-demand and widely used programming language.
That’s why we designed this absolute beginner’s course on only everything you must know about Java.
Get up and running with your first object-oriented programming projects.
You’ll learn all the core fundamentals you need to become a rockstar Java developer.
Start here if you have no programming experience or are coming from another programming language to learn transferable, actionable skills.






